The Economic and Social Data Service (ESDS) is a new national data service that came into operation in January 2003. ESDS International, hosted by MIMAS at the University of Manchester is a specialist service of the ESDS which provides access to, and support for, a range of international datasets - both macro and micro sources. The service aims to promote and facilitate increased and more effective use of international datasets in research, learning and teaching across a range of disciplines. ESDS International provides UK academics with free online access to the macro datasets via the Beyond 20/20 Web Data Server, a fully accessible application specifically designed for data dissemination, analysis and visualisation. The data portfolio is built around international statistical databanks that collectively chart over 50 years of global, social and economic change. The key databanks include OECD's Main Economic Indicators, IMF Direction of Trade and International Financial Statistics, UNIDO's Industrial Statistics and Demand Supply databases and the World Bank's World Development Indicators and Global Development Finance.
